How to get wax off of linoleum floor?

How to get wax off of linoleum floor? Isopropyl alcohol — regular rubbing alcohol — removes candle-wax residue from vinyl flooring. Pour some rubbing alcohol onto a soft white cloth, and then blot the spot with the cloth. If blotting doesn’t work, wipe the spot. Wipe the vinyl again with a damp white cloth afterward, using water in place of alcohol.

What kind of snowboard wax should i use?

Warm rated (Red or Yellow) hydrocarbon is best above 25 F. It is a great wax to ski on but is also used for conditioning a new base and is the best wax for hot-wax-scrape-cleaning. Cold rated (Green or Blue) hydrocarbon is best below 25 F.

How to take out the wax from a candle?

Place the candle in the freezer for several hours or until it is frozen. The wax should pop right out of the container, but you can also loosen it with a butter knife if necessary. Scrape off any residue and then clean the container with soap and water.

How long before waxing new car paint?

The last thing you want to do is wax your car as soon as the new paint dries. If you apply wax too soon, it will interrupt the curing process, which can weaken the paint and make it easier to scratch or damage. Instead, wait 60 to 90 days before waxing.

Can earbuds cause wax buildup?

Earbuds can increase ear wax build up. Even though our ears are self-cleaning, if we block the canal for multiple hours a day, the wax will not be able to work itself out of the ear. Sometimes, this forms a large plug of earwax, and your earbuds can push the wax deeper, causing trauma to the ear and ear pain.

What is the cost to strip and wax vct tile?

Strip and wax jobs are charged by the square foot. The price you charge your client can vary due to several factors, but the national average is 30 to 60 cents per square foot. However, some jobs can go up to 90 cents or more depending on how difficult the job is.

How can i get candle wax out of clothing?

Small spots of hardened candle wax can be removed from fabric by rubbing with a generous dollop of vegetable oil. Wipe off any excess oil with paper towels, then launder as usual. Another way to remove small amounts of wax from a tablecloth is to put the linen in the freezer.

What temperature do i add fragrance to soy wax?

Add your fragrance at the right temp: Adding your fragrance oil when your wax is at the proper temperature will help it bind to the wax, which will help give you a stronger scent throw. It is usually recommended to add your fragrance to the wax at 180-185F for soy and paraffin wax 200-205F for palm wax.
